当前位置: 首页 > news >正文

可以做fiting网站如何进行网络营销策划

可以做fiting网站,如何进行网络营销策划,武汉网站建设是什么,建筑交流平台目录 一、QLinstWidget-用于显示项目列表的窗口部件: 1.1QLinstWidget介绍: 1.2属性介绍: 1.3常用方法介绍: 1.4信号介绍: 1.5实例演示: 二、QTableWidget- 用于显示二维数据表: 2.1QTabl…

目录

一、QLinstWidget-用于显示项目列表的窗口部件:

1.1QLinstWidget介绍:

1.2属性介绍:

1.3常用方法介绍:

 1.4信号介绍:

1.5实例演示:

二、QTableWidget- 用于显示二维数据表:

2.1QTableWidget介绍:

2.2常用方法介绍:

2.3 信号介绍:


一、QLinstWidget-用于显示项目列表的窗口部件:

1.1QLinstWidget介绍:

  • QListWidget提供了一个用于显示项目列表的窗口部件。
  • QListWidget 继承自 QListView,并且使用一个简单的接口来管理列表中的项。
  • 它适合于那些需要一个列表框,但又不想使用 QListView 和 QAbstractItemModel 的复杂接口的情况。

1.2属性介绍:

count
  • 返回列表中项目的数量。
  • count()
currentItem
  • 获取当前选中的项目。
  • currentItem() const
  • setCurrentItem(QListWidgetItem *item)
currentRow
  • 获取当前选中项目的行号。如果未选中返回-1。
  • currentRow() const
  • setCurrentRow(int row)
selectionMode
  • 设置选择模式,可以是单选、多选等。
  • selectionMode() const
  • setSelectionMode(QAbstractItemView::SelectionMode mode)
item
  • 获取指定行的项目。
  • item(int row) const
itemWidget
  • 获取项目关联的窗口小部件。
  • itemWidget(QListWidgetItem *item) const
  • setItemWidget(QListWidgetItem *item, QWidget *widget)
sortingEnabled
  • 设置是否启用项目排序。
  • isSortingEnabled() const
  • setSortingEnabled(bool enable)
dropIndicatorPosition
  • 设置或获取拖放操作中的指示位置。
  • dropIndicatorPosition() const

1.3常用方法介绍:

addItem
  • 向列表中添加一个项目。
  • void addItem(const QString &label)
  • void addItem(QListWidgetItem *item)
currentItem
  • 获取/设置当前选中的项目。
  • void currentItem()
  • setCurrentItem(QListWidgetItem *item)
insertItem
  • 在指定行插入一个项目。
  • void insertItem(int row, const QString &label)
  • void insertItem(int row, QListWidgetItem *item)
item
  • 获取指定行的项目。
  • item(int row) const
sortItems
  • 对列表中的项目进行排序。
  • void sortItems(Qt::SortOrder order = Qt::AscendingOrder)
clear
  • 移除列表中的所有项目。
  • clear();
takeItem
  • 从列表中移除指定行的项目并返回该项目。
  • QListWidgetItem* takeItem(int row)

 1.4信号介绍:

currentItemChanged当前选中项目发生变化时发出此信号。
itemActivated用户激活项目(例如通过双击或按 Enter 键)时发出此信号。
itemChanged项目内容发生变化时发出此信号。
itemDoubleClicked用户双击项目时发出此信号。
itemEntered鼠标指针进入项目时发出此信号。
itemClicked用户单击项目时发出此信号。
currentRowChanged当前选中的行发生变化时发出此信号。参数是新的当前选中行的行号。

1.5实例演示:

Widget::Widget(QWidget *parent): QWidget(parent), ui(new Ui::Widget)
{ui->setupUi(this);
}Widget::~Widget()
{delete ui;
}//展示当前选中项,如果选中,显示当前高亮项
void Widget::on_listWidget_itemClicked(QListWidgetItem *item)
{if(item==nullptr)return;ui->label->setText("当前选中项:"+item->text());
}//添加项目,获取lineedit中的字段,添加到窗口作为新项目
void Widget::on_pushButton_clicked()
{const QString& str=ui->lineEdit->text();ui->listWidget->addItem(str);ui->lineEdit->clear();
}//删除项目,先获取选中项目的行号,然后通过行号删除项目
void Widget::on_pushButton_2_clicked()
{int num=ui->listWidget->currentRow();if(num<0)return;ui->listWidget->takeItem(num);}

 

二、QTableWidget- 用于显示二维数据表:

2.1QTableWidget介绍:

  • QTableWidget 是 Qt 提供的一个表格控件,用于显示二维数据表。
  • 它是 QTableView 的一个子类,提供了更高级的功能,允许用户直接在表格中添加、删除和编辑项。

2.2常用方法介绍:

item
  • 获取指定单元格的项目。
  • QTableWidgetItem* item(int row, int column) const
setItem
  • 设置指定单元格的项目。
  • void setItem(int row, int column, QTableWidgetItem *item)
currentItem
  • 获取当前选中的项目。
  • QTableWidgetItem* currentItem() const
currentRow
  • 获取当前选中项目的行号。
  • int currentRow() const
currentColumn
  • 获取当前选中项目的列号。
  • int currentColumn() const
row
  • 获取某个项所在的行。
  • int row(const QTableWidgetItem *item) const
column
  • 获取某个 QTableWidgetItem 所在的列。
  • int column(const QTableWidgetItem *item) const
rowCount
  • 获取表格的行数。
  • int rowCount() const
columnCount
  • 获取表格的列数。
  • int columnCount() const
insertRow
  • 在指定位置插入一行。
  • void insertRow(int row)

insertColumn

  • 在指定位置插入一列。
  • int column(const QTableWidgetItem *item) const
removeRow
  • 移除指定行。
  • void removeRow(int row)
removeColumn
  • 移除指定列。
  • void removeColumn(int column)
setHorizontalHeaderItem
  • 设置水平表头的单元格项目。
  • void setHorizontalHeaderItem(int column, QTableWidgetItem *item)
setVerticalHeaderItem
  • 设置垂直表头的单元格项目。
  • void setVerticalHeaderItem(int row, QTableWidgetItem *item)

2.3 信号介绍:

cellClicked(int row, int column)
  • 当用户单击单元格时触发。
  • row:被单击的单元格的行号。
  • column:被单击的单元格的列号。
cellDoubleClicked(int row, int column)
  • 当用户双击单元格时触发。
  • row:被双击的单元格的行号。
  • column:被双击的单元格的列号。
cellEntered(int row, int column)
  • 当鼠标进入单元格时触发。
  • row:鼠标进入的单元格的行号。
  • column:鼠标进入的单元格的列号。
currentCellChanged(int currentRow, int currentColumn, int previousRow, int previousColumn)
  • 当当前选中的单元格发生变化时触发。
  • currentRow:当前选中的单元格的行号。
  • currentColumn:当前选中的单元格的列号。
  • previousRow:之前选中的单元格的行号。
  • previousColumn:之前选中的单元格的列号。

文章转载自:
http://yachtie.przc.cn
http://virose.przc.cn
http://soliloquist.przc.cn
http://affecting.przc.cn
http://snowpack.przc.cn
http://numbles.przc.cn
http://featherwit.przc.cn
http://dottel.przc.cn
http://rallyingly.przc.cn
http://palace.przc.cn
http://nemoral.przc.cn
http://silvicolous.przc.cn
http://inspectoscope.przc.cn
http://bituminize.przc.cn
http://converse.przc.cn
http://purposely.przc.cn
http://types.przc.cn
http://ablastin.przc.cn
http://ketch.przc.cn
http://bolivar.przc.cn
http://decimal.przc.cn
http://lampless.przc.cn
http://transmutable.przc.cn
http://candlefish.przc.cn
http://mastless.przc.cn
http://ethnologic.przc.cn
http://reword.przc.cn
http://unguinous.przc.cn
http://strata.przc.cn
http://distinct.przc.cn
http://evangelicalism.przc.cn
http://riprap.przc.cn
http://chromyl.przc.cn
http://microblade.przc.cn
http://spiderlike.przc.cn
http://rub.przc.cn
http://reconstructive.przc.cn
http://tdb.przc.cn
http://forbidding.przc.cn
http://ecotage.przc.cn
http://methanol.przc.cn
http://lobectomy.przc.cn
http://tried.przc.cn
http://abnormity.przc.cn
http://chromascope.przc.cn
http://gemmiform.przc.cn
http://tunic.przc.cn
http://semiaxis.przc.cn
http://oratress.przc.cn
http://demarcative.przc.cn
http://subsume.przc.cn
http://disimpassioned.przc.cn
http://neckrein.przc.cn
http://luftmensch.przc.cn
http://computistical.przc.cn
http://slake.przc.cn
http://lichenometrical.przc.cn
http://nectarize.przc.cn
http://imroz.przc.cn
http://prism.przc.cn
http://submetacentric.przc.cn
http://ave.przc.cn
http://pregnant.przc.cn
http://overweigh.przc.cn
http://reversed.przc.cn
http://net.przc.cn
http://cormophyte.przc.cn
http://copesmate.przc.cn
http://rounce.przc.cn
http://disappearance.przc.cn
http://undercliff.przc.cn
http://poorness.przc.cn
http://amphitheater.przc.cn
http://contrafluxion.przc.cn
http://goldbug.przc.cn
http://sopping.przc.cn
http://cookroom.przc.cn
http://coversed.przc.cn
http://spicule.przc.cn
http://seoul.przc.cn
http://bum.przc.cn
http://inthral.przc.cn
http://capercaillie.przc.cn
http://denny.przc.cn
http://against.przc.cn
http://lymphangiitis.przc.cn
http://plagiostome.przc.cn
http://salvershaped.przc.cn
http://accommodable.przc.cn
http://vacuolate.przc.cn
http://tasset.przc.cn
http://hecla.przc.cn
http://sculp.przc.cn
http://doubloon.przc.cn
http://airconditioned.przc.cn
http://smasheroo.przc.cn
http://detumescent.przc.cn
http://antidrug.przc.cn
http://flamingo.przc.cn
http://eutelegenesis.przc.cn
http://www.15wanjia.com/news/60745.html

相关文章:

  • 秦皇岛市城乡建设局网站深圳搜索引擎优化推广便宜
  • 发布设计任务的网站网络搜索引擎
  • 动态网站开发全流程图环球网疫情最新
  • 做网站什么颜色和蓝色配站长平台工具
  • 浙江网站建设方案优化seo技术大师
  • 泊头网站建设优化疫情防控 这些措施你应该知道
  • 网站开发平台及常用开发工具赣州seo优化
  • 建设b2c商城网站百度推广的方式
  • 哪些网站专做新闻淘宝标题优化工具推荐
  • vue 做企业网站怎么做一个网站页面
  • 建设网站建设多少钱软文文案案例
  • asp网站水印支除网站策划书模板
  • 建站资源共享推广图片大全
  • 毕业设计做购物网站爱网
  • 南京企业网站设计整站快速排名
  • 门户网站建设谈判百度网页提交入口
  • 哪些网站是vue做的百度热线人工服务电话
  • 无锡做网站baidu什么叫做seo
  • 做淘宝网站用什么软件有哪些抖音权重查询工具
  • 高校网站模板谷歌浏览器 安卓下载2023版官网
  • 做图片可以卖给那些网站成功的网络营销案例有哪些
  • 中小学网站建设规范天津百度快速优化排名
  • 手机网站做的比较好的北京seo公司有哪些
  • 广州版单一窗口如何做网站推广及优化
  • 电子商务网站建设与管理程序设计题营销型网站建设应该考虑哪些因素
  • 宁波网站推广软件哪家强怎么弄一个网站
  • wordpress网站聊天插件磁力多多
  • 我的网站wordpress信息流优化师是做什么的
  • 网站建设优化营销型网站建设流程
  • 宝马的高端品牌叫什么北京seo编辑